2011-08-18 37 views
3

昨天我發現了一個使用Objective-C:Sudzc的WebServices庫。 我嘗試使用這個,我在調用方法中的參數有問題。 我把這樣的:傳遞SudzC的參數

SDZMobileActionsBeanService *service = [SDZMobileActionsBeanService service]; 
[service getListMobileMenuItemByMobileApplicationId:self action:@selector(getApp:) arg0:15]; 

爲arg0是我的觀點,當肥皂發送請求給我的JBoss服務器我看到,arg0都爲空。 我試着用wsdl2objc庫也是一樣的結果。 我不知道爲什麼,有什麼建議?

謝謝

+0

由於arg0聲明瞭什麼類型? –

+0

@rudy velthuis arg0很長 – Sebastien

+0

@Rudy Valthuis如果arg0是一個NSString – Sebastien

回答

0

您可能需要將字符串轉換爲int或反之亦然。檢查生成的代碼以查看sudzc聲明的內容。

NSString *string = blah; 
int value = [string intValue];